I can see where a loose point (not tight to the front of the shaft so impact is transferred to the front of the arrow shaft) could seriously test the integrity of the bond between the HIT and the inside of the arrow shaft. All or most of the impact force would be trasferred to the insert, which has no bearing surface on the front of the shaft itself. The HIT is only kept from being slammed back into the shaft by the strength of the epoxy bond. If the point is tight, the front of the shaft should take most of the impact.
